- LibreOffice – The Complete Office Alternative
Forget subscription fees—LibreOffice offers a full suite (Writer, Calc, Impress, and more) that handles everything from proposals to presentations. It’s compatible with Microsoft Office formats and supports 110 languages, making collaboration seamless.(techradar.com) - GIMP, Krita & Inkscape – Creative Suite Without the Price Tag
- GIMP: A robust photo editor with layers, plug-ins, and advanced editing capabilities—ideal for quick design tasks or image adjustments.(bulkwp.com)
- Krita 6.0: Optimized for digital painting and illustration, now with GPU-accelerated brushes and animation features.(alibaba.com)
- Inkscape 1.4: A vector graphics tool with full SVG 2.0 compliance and responsive design support—perfect for logos, infographics, and web visuals.(alibaba.com)
- Shotcut & DaVinci Resolve – Video Editing for Every Level
- Shotcut: A user-friendly editor with support for a wide range of formats and GPU-accelerated filters—great for quick edits.(digitalab.org)
- DaVinci Resolve: A professional-grade editor offering advanced color grading, audio editing, and VFX—an exceptional choice for polished video content.(digitalab.org)
- VLC Media Player – The Universal Playback Tool
Need to preview media across a variety of formats? VLC plays virtually anything—videos, audio, streams, DVDs—without extra codecs.(digitalab.org) - 7-Zip – Fast and Secure File Compression
Whether sending large media files or managing archives, 7-Zip delivers high compression, AES-256 encryption, and seamless Windows integration.(bulkwp.com) - OBS Studio – Screen Recording & Live Streaming Powerhouse
From recording tutorials to hosting webinars or live streams, OBS gives you scene control, virtual cameras, and plugin support—making it indispensable for content creation.(bulkwp.com) - KeePassXC or Bitwarden – Secure Password Management
Maintain client and tool passwords securely with open-source managers. KeePassXC keeps data encrypted offline, while Bitwarden (or its self-hosted variant Vaultwarden) offers cross-device sync and encrypted sharing.(bulkwp.com) - Notepad++ – Lightweight, Feature-Rich Text Editing
From editing code snippets to writing quick notes, Notepad++ offers syntax highlighting, macros, and multi-tab support—ideal for marketers working with HTML, scripts, or text files.(bulkwp.com) - ShareX – Advanced Screenshot & Capture Tool
Capture full webpages, record screens, annotate, redact sensitive info, and even automate post-capture workflows—ShareX is a powerhouse for documentation, tutorials, and visual feedback.(makeuseof.com) - Rufus – Create Bootable USBs with Ease
Whether you’re testing Linux, performing system recovery, or setting up multiple client PCs, Rufus makes creating bootable media quick and reliable.(bulkwp.com)

Quick Installation Tips for Agencies
- Use Windows Package Manager (winget) or batch scripts to automate installations across your team.(findarticles.com)
- Store configuration files in shared drives or Nextcloud for consistent setups.(medium.com)
- Combine tools like Nextcloud with OnlyOffice for collaborative document editing and file sharing.(medium.com)
